Project Highlight – Highlawn House

Based in Melbourne’s inner western suburbs, Highlawn House is a design triumph with its striking exterior that draws you in to reveal a sweeping spiral staircase and soaring voids that set the tone for a home of precise grandeur. Generous in both scale and spirit, every space has been shaped with meticulous design intent, blending size with the warmth and functionality of modern family living.

Zenn Design was engaged extensively throughout the home, from custom window furnishings complete with motorisation, custom indoor and outdoor fixed/loose upholstery, dining stools, bespoke beds and ottomans. Every piece was developed in close collaboration with Rachel Portaro of Lume Interiors, aligning seamlessly with the home’s bold architectural statement and refined design narrative.
